首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

如何使用curl在两个不同站点中发布用户id

使用curl在两个不同站点中发布用户id可以通过以下步骤实现:

  1. 首先,确保你已经安装了curl命令行工具。curl是一个强大的用于与服务器进行数据交互的工具,可以发送HTTP请求并获取响应。
  2. 打开终端或命令提示符窗口,并使用以下命令发送POST请求将用户id发布到第一个站点:
代码语言:txt
复制

curl -X POST -d "user_id=123" https://site1.com/publish

代码语言:txt
复制

这个命令中,-X POST表示发送POST请求,-d "user_id=123"表示将用户id设置为123并作为请求的数据体发送,https://site1.com/publish是第一个站点的发布用户id的API接口。

  1. 接下来,使用类似的命令将用户id发布到第二个站点。假设第二个站点的API接口为https://site2.com/publish,则命令如下:
代码语言:txt
复制

curl -X POST -d "user_id=123" https://site2.com/publish

代码语言:txt
复制
  1. 通过以上步骤,你可以使用curl在两个不同站点中发布用户id。根据实际需求,你可以将用户id和其他参数进行调整和扩展。

注意:以上命令中的站点和API接口仅为示例,实际应用中需要根据具体情况进行替换。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

如何使用mimicLInux以普通用户身份来隐藏进程

关于mimic mimic是一款针对进程隐藏的安全工具,该工具的帮助下,广大研究人员可以通过普通用户身份来Linux操作系统(x86_64)上隐藏某个进程的执行。...任何用户都可以使用它,它不需要特殊权限,也不需要特殊的二进制文件。除此之外,它也不需要root kit。...root用户运行的kworker线程应该非常可疑。...这将允许我们选择进程列表我们所希望进程出现的位置。需要注意的是,内核为内核线程保留了前300个pid。如果你试图低于这个值,你可能最终会得到进程pid 301。...许可证协议 本项目的开发与发布遵循MIT开源许可证协议。 项目地址 mimic:https://github.com/emptymonkey/mimic

40130
  • curl_init()

    版权声明:署名-非商业性使用-禁止演绎 2.0 摘要: 在这篇文章主要讲解php_curl库的知识,并教你如何更好的使用php_curl。...这里有几个解决方式;最简单的就是php中使用fopen()函数,但是fopen函数没有足够的参数来使用,比如当你想构建一个“网络爬虫”,想定义爬虫的客户端描述(IE,firefox),通过不同的请求方式来获取内容...为了解决我们上面提出的问题,我们可以使用PHP的扩展库-Curl,这个扩展库通常是默认安装包的,你可以它来获取其他站点的内容,也可以来干别的。.../configure后加上 –with-curl 在这篇文章,我们一起来看看如何使用curl库,并看看它的其他用处,但是接下来,我们要从最基本的用法开始 基本用法: 第一步,我们通过函数curl_init...结论: 在这篇文章我已经表明,如何使用phpcurl库和其大部分的选项。

    98020

    wordpress 内容备份镜像站点建立方法及注意事项

    作为虾米级站长一枚,实则是不懂代码的菜鸟,由于自己的站点是小水管主机,而且稳定性也难以保障,很多访客的建议下,也想建立一个内容镜像站点,以实现当主站的主机维护时,能够有一个备用站点让访客访问。...最先我是想能够有一个共用的数据库可以给两个站点一起使用,但百度查了资料后,发现这对于虚拟主机建站来说好像不适用。 直到找到了以下的代码,可以实现源站发表文章时,自动镜像站点也发表出来。...//文章推送 add_action('publish_post', 'fanly_sync_post'); //钩子,文章发布时执行 function fanly_sync_post($post_ID...ch ); return $ret; } } 这样一来,主站发表一篇文章后,镜像站点也就会发表出来一篇文章了,但也会有一些意外情况,比如不是马上发表出来,而是显示计划,正常隔几分钟后会发表好,但也会有发表失败...,需要在后台文章管理,选择该发表失败文章,状态修改为已发布,更新即可。

    93930

    关于allow_url_fopen的设置与服务器的安全–不理解

    == false) { // do something with the content echo str; } curl_close( 如何对PHP程序的常见漏洞进行攻击 正如我们前面讨论的那样...事实上,当一个session启动时(实际上是配置文件设置为第一次请求时自动启动),就会生成一个随机的“session id”,如果远程浏览器总是发送请求时提交这个“session id”的话,session...这通过Cookie很容易实现,也可以通过每页提交一个表单变量(包含“session id”)来实现。...> 上面的代码假定如果“$session_auth”被置位的话,就是从session,而不是从用户输入来置位的,如果攻击者通过表单输入来置位的话,他就可以获得对站点的访问权。...多主机系统,因为文件是以运行Web服务器的用户身份(一般是nobody)保存的,因此恶意的站点拥有者就可以通过创建一个session文件来获得对其它站点的访问,甚至可以检查session文件的敏感信息

    1.2K10

    打造一个舒服的写作环境(Hexo)

    查看talking.ejs内容 code0 第二步 主题配置文件配置云开发参数 主题配置文件themes/stellar/_config.yml为动态页面配置云开发参数,云开发参数的获取请参考云开发相关文档...相比于 Netlify,Vercel CDN 分布广、免费功能较为齐全(Vercel 免费用户提供每个月 100GB 的流量,跟 Github Pages 是一样的)、中国大陆访问站点在台湾速度快以及有命令行程序...如何使用GitHub Actions部署hexo博客,网上有一大堆的教程,这里主要记录一下多个文件夹分离的GitHub仓库管理的场景下如何配置GitHub Actions。...: 主题文件,fork自原主题仓库 如何发布 由于GitHub对白嫖用户的私有仓库使用GitHub Actions每个月有时间限制。...节点增加: repository_dispatch: types: Hexo 表示该仓库允许通过webhook的方式来触发action,并且指定类型为Hexo(体现在其他两个仓库的curl请求参数里

    1.6K31

    kong 简明介绍「建议收藏」

    本主题中,您将配置前面创建的服务(example_service),使其指向上游而不是主机。对于我们的示例,上游将指向两个不同的目标,httpbin.org和mockbin.org。...实际环境,上游将指向多个系统上运行的相同服务。 下面是一个说明设置的图表: 6.2 为什么要跨上游目标进行负载平衡? 在下面的示例,您将使用两个不同服务器或上游目标部署的应用程序。...6.3 配置上游(Upstream)服务 本节,您将创建一个名为 Upstream 的上游upstream并向其添加两个目标。...管理行政(Administrative)团队 本主题中,您将学习如何使用Kong Gateway(企业)的工作空间和团队管理和配置用户授权。 7.1 工作区和团队概述 许多组织都有严格的安全要求。...例如,将一个工作区命名为“Payments”和另一个“payments”将创建两个看起来相同的不同工作区。 警告: 授予对默认工作区的访问权限可以访问组织的所有工作区。

    2K30

    WordPress发布文章主动推送到百度,加快收录保护原创

    主动推送支持多种途径:比如 curl 、post、php 以及 ruby 等。而且支持一次性提交多条网站页面地址,不过每个站点每天可推送的次数暂时限制 50 次。...①、及时发现:可以缩短百度爬虫发现您站点新链接的时间,使新发布的页面可以第一时间被百度收录 ②、保护原创:对于网站的最新原创内容,使用主动推送功能可以快速通知到百度,使内容可以转发之前被百度发现...先摘一段来自鱼叔的相关描述: PHP 中发起 HTTP 请求并不是很难,有很多种方法:使用 fopen() 函数,使用 CURL 扩展,使用文件操作函数如 fsockopen() 和 fwrite(...-------摘自我爱水煮鱼《使用 WP_Http WordPress 中发起 HTTP Request》 简单的修改一下之前的代码,即可轻松搞定: /** * WordPress发布文章主动推送到百度...快速推送带来的好处是两方面的:一是及时发现,可以缩短百度爬虫发现您站点新链接的时间,使新发布的页面可以第一时间被百度收录;二是保护原创,对于网站的最新原创内容,使用主动推送功能可以快速通知到百度,使内容可以转发之前被百度发现

    1.5K60

    分布式系统开发实战:实战,使用AWS平台实现Serverless架构

    ·全球所有玩家的持久化信息(包括用户基本信息、等级、装备、进度等状态信息)都保存在中心站点。玩家统一通过HTTP(S)登录中心站点并获取状态信息。...·对战初始,由中心站点对玩家进行重定向到对应的Game Server。 在对战过程使用TCP长连接从而保证更好的游戏体验。...基于上述的架构,游戏完全构建在统一的“大世界”(唯一站点),并且由分布全球的Game Server来保证游戏的低延迟。...由于Game Server分布全球不同的地区,如何做到资源的快速扩展和按需伸缩将是一个难点。下面将以Serverless架构的方式阐述实现这一需求。.../bin/bash #get instance-id from local meta-data id=$(curl -s http://169.254.169.254/ latest/meta-data

    1.8K10

    wordpress实现发布文章主动推送(实时)给百度的方法

    使用方法就是需要把JS代码安装在网站整站共用的模板页面,比方说header.htm类似的页头模板页面安装,以达到一处安装,全站皆有的效果。...但是,百度搜索引擎会使用Sitemap的数据来了解网站的结构等信息,这样可以帮助百度搜索引擎蜘蛛改进抓取策略,并在日后能更好地对网站进行抓取。...= "publish"){ $url = get_permalink($post_ID); $ch = curl_init(); $options = array( CURLOPT_URL => $api...= "publish"){ $url = get_permalink($post_ID); $ch = curl_init(); $options = array( CURLOPT_URL => $api...\n\n"; } fwrite($handle,$resultMessage); fclose($handle); } } } 上面这段代码有两个api,把它们都改成你自己的就可以了。

    1.3K20

    jenkins 之 复杂发布场景概述

    复杂发布场景概述 企业,要实现敏捷开发,必须结合jenkins的众多插件来实现更牛逼的特性。 思考一个问题:企业究竟如何进行管理项目发布的?代码的回滚怎么做?...测试环境:一般本地机房,不同迭代对应不同的测试环境,如何保证环境不冲突,交付测试后如何最快通知相关人员跟进 离线/灰度/UAT环境:目前大部分在云环境上构建 生产环境:云服务器环境,如何快速备份发布多个节点...代码的复用性大大提高 我们需要使用两个插件 插件:Build with Parameters和Extended Choice Parameter,默认已经安装 其中用得最多的是String...通过参数化构建,我们可以取到构建人员究竟是想根据参数做什么操作,我们可以提前shell脚本做好对应的判断,比如1-是发布,我们可以调用发布的脚本代码,0-回滚,可以通过参数判断调用回滚的代码。...Jenkins user ID jinkins 用户ID BUILD_USER_EMAIL Email address 用户邮箱 配置项目的时候一定要勾选Set jenkins user build

    24230

    DiscuzX3.5一直通信失败或DiscuzX3.5一直正在连接状态k8s或k3

    DiscuzX3.5一直通信失败或DiscuzX3.5一直正在连接状态k8s或k3s环境下如何成功调试”,先说缘起!为了更好服务于情感培训的学员,于是准备把之前自己的社区重新恢复回来。...xdebug安装成功之后,用命令kubectl exec -it CONTAINER_ID – bash进入到容器内部,用命令php -m查看,发现xdebug已经正常安装,discuz入口文件phpinfo...如下图,这里要按我图中所说进行配置但是还没完,最狗的事情其实也在这里,如果告诉你配置,你配置了,那么,配置这个地址能被使用,估计也就没有问题了,可关键来了,discuzX3.5你尽管配,我压根不会用,...如下图:图中所示部分是我修改后的,这样ip地址可以curl建立与discuz通信时被用到,这里原来值是特么'',而这个dfopen第六个参数就是ip地址,那压根你怎么传ip都不会被使用,就很。。。...,同时概括下这种情况下的处理思路,首先排除一下curl本身参数配置导致的问题,再排除一下是不是请求地址存在问题,这两个排查点都可以用构建一个最简单的curl资源的方式排查到,如下:$ch = curl_init

    30500

    docker 及 docker-compose 的快速安装和简单使用

    本篇将使用 DaoCloud 源 Ubuntu 上简单快速安装 docker 及 docker-compose 并添加了通过 Dockerfile 及 docker-compose.yml 使用...、发布、运行任何的应用 安装 curl -sSL https://get.daocloud.io/docker | sh 安装后将会自动重启 卸载 sudo apt-get remove docker.../etc/nginx/conf.d/ # 将发布目录的文件拷贝到镜像 COPY dist/ /usr/share/nginx/html/ nginx vue history 模式的配置 如下,可参考...docker-compose.yml 文件 通过以下配置,在运行后可以创建两个站点(只为演示) version: "3" services: web1: image: registry.cn-hangzhou.aliyuncs.com...ip+port 访问这两个站点了 3.镜像更新重新部署 docker-compose down docker-compose pull docker-compose up -d 相关文章 docker

    1.8K20

    hexo-butterfly-SEO优化

    ​ 上述步骤完成,百度搜索框内输入site:域名,查看收录情况,如果没有收录则提交网址进行收录,登录百度账号->用户中心->站点管理->添加网站(输入网站、配置站点属性、验证网站) ​...我采用的是CNAME验证的方式进行验证,根据提示将指定的记录使用CNAME解析到ziyuan.baidu.com即可(例如使用github二级域名则为code-xxxxxxx.用户名.github.io...用 API 推送后,索引量迅速回升 ​ 如果需要搜索引擎收录网站,则需要对应搜索引擎的管理平台进行提交,各自的验证码可以从管理平台获取 API提交方式收录(curl/post/php/ruby等多种不同的方式进行推送...,访问用户中心->站点管理->普通收录->API提交(记录秘钥) ​ 对应的token则参考相应的推送接口URL的token即可 ​ 登录必应站长平台,访问设置->API access(API...Travis持续集成 如果使用 Github Action ,还需 yml 文件设置环境变量 ​ github对应hexo发布仓库:Settings->Secrets->Actions-

    1.8K20

    如何加速WordPress网站

    测试响应时间 curl您的故障排除之前,从家用计算机运行此命令以测试站点速度: time curl http:// -s 1>/dev/null 12.79...浏览器重新加载WordPress网站。顶部的管理菜单栏,您将看到橙色突出显示的站点统计信息集合。...慢速代码也可以WordPress主题中找到,因此如果你插件找不到瓶颈,那么尝试不同的主题也是一个好主意。 最佳实践 除了识别代码的瓶颈外,您还可以实施一般最佳实践来加速您的网站。...Linode提供了优化Apache和MySQL的指南: 调整Apache服务器 如何使用MySQLTuner优化MySQL性能 可选:配置您自己的WordPress站点 您可以重复使用本指南提供的XHGUI...WordPress代码中找到瓶颈 分析WordPress性能 使用XHProf和XHGUI进行分析 Tideways XHProf Extension XHGUI 如何使用Docker Compose

    4.2K30

    PHP curl_init函数——爬虫必备

    原文地址:http://www.jb51.net/article/25193.htm 我们可以使用PHP的扩展库-Curl,这个扩展库通常是默认安装包的,你可以它来获取其他站点的内容,也可以来干别的.../configure后加上 –with-curl 在这篇文章,我们一起来看看如何使用curl库,并看看它的其他用处,但是接下来,我们要从最基本的用法开始 基本用法: 第一步,我们通过函数curl_init...完全没有问题,curl_setopt()函数的参数,如果希望获得内容但不输出,使用 CURLOPT_RETURNTRANSFER参数,并设为非0值/true!...> 在上面的2个实例,你可能注意到通过设置函数curl_setopt()的不同参数,可以获得不同结果,这正是curl强大的原因,下面我们来看看这些参数的含义。...如果CURLOPT_AUTOREFERER 设置为true时,curl会自动添加Referer header每一个跳转链接,可能它不是很重要,但是一定的案例却非常的有用。

    1.9K30

    HTB渗透之Tenten

    steghide 分析图片,成功拿到id_rsa steghide extract -sf HackerAccessGranted.jpg 一般而言id_rsa SSH 作为私钥使用 cat...私钥登录 尝试利用该私钥登录 SSH,首先赋予其 400 权限 chmod 400 id_rsa 使用私钥登录用户takis,当然还要输入密码 ssh -i id_rsa takis@10.10.10.10...在当前用户家目录成功找到第一个flag cat user.txt 0x03 权限提升[root] 信息收集 检查当前用户sudo权限,结果显示可使用 sudo 命令执行任意超级用户的权限,但前提是需要拥有当前用户的密码...尝试利用 wpscan 扫描发现用户名 takis 和 WordPress 插件 Job Manager,插件存在两个漏洞,分别是 XSS 以及 IDOR,针对 IDOR 漏洞枚举查找简历,最终成功找到一张使用隐写术的图片...服务器检查当前用户的 sudo 权限,发现/bin/fuckin无需密码便可通过 sudo 执行,因此 sudo 命令配合/bin/fuckin可成功提权至 root 权限。

    48120

    详细拆解导航流程:从输入URL到页面展示,这中间发生了什么?

    用户输入 当用户地址栏输入一个查询关键字时,地址栏会判断输入的关键字是搜索内容,还是请求的 URL。 搜素内容:地址栏会使用浏览器默认的搜索引擎,来合成新的带搜索关键字的URL。...ID 是 23601。...,你可以参考下图: 非同一站点使用不同的渲染进程 从图中任务管理器可以看出:由于极客邦和极客时间的标签页拥有相同的协议和根域名,所以它们属于同一站点,并运行在同一个渲染进程;而 infoq.cn 的根域名不同于...geekbang.org,也就是说 InfoQ 和极客邦不属于同一站点,因此它们会运行在两个不同的渲染进程之中。...Chrome 默认采用每个标签对应一个渲染进程,但是如果两个页面属于同一站点,那这两个标签会使用同一个渲染进程。 浏览器的导航过程涵盖了从用户发起请求到提交文档给渲染进程的中间所有阶段。

    1.3K20
    领券